A 58-year-old man in the ICU with ventilator-associated pneumonia is started on tigecycline. Blood cultures grow Pseudomonas aeruginosa. Despite appropriate susceptibility-adjusted dosing, he deteriorates. The most important limitation of tigecycline explaining this outcome is:
- A It has no intrinsic activity against Gram-negative bacilli
- B It is rapidly degraded by pulmonary beta-lactamases
- C It achieves very low serum concentrations because it distributes extensively into tissues ✓
- D It antagonizes concurrently administered beta-lactams
Explanation
Tigecycline has a huge volume of distribution because it penetrates tissues avidly, leaving very low serum and urinary concentrations. It is approved for complicated intra-abdominal, skin and community-acquired infections but is not indicated for hospital-acquired or ventilator-associated pneumonia or bloodstream infection, and it has no useful activity against Pseudomonas. Meta-analyses have shown increased mortality when tigecycline is used outside its approved indications.
